Agenda & Speakers

Loyalty360 Awards Presentations | Technology & Trends

Thursday, November 19, 2020 - 3:00 PM - 4:00 PM
The finalists competing in the 2020 Loyalty360 Awards will share details of their programs and strategies in fast-paced, 10-15 minute presentations. These presentations give attendees a chance to hear first-hand from the brands that are delivering experiences that set them apart from the competition and create happy, loyal customers.

Each finalist will create a video presentation and all attendees will have the ability to watch videos from all finalists in each category. 

As a part of the award process, all registered conference attendees are eligible to vote for platinum, gold, silver, bronze and honorable mention (if applicable) for each category. 

Category videos will be posted throughout the virtual event on LoyaltyExpo.com. Once the category video goes live, voting will be open until December 1.

Michael O'Brien, Manager - Marketing Products & Innovation, Caesars Entertainment

Mike has been with Caesars Entertainment for the last two Years, previously working for Citigroup. He holds a BBA, Finance from Texas A&M University and an MBA from USC Marshall School of Business. 

With Caesars, his main responsibilities include onboarding new and supporting existing properties on the UrVenue platform, set up, traning, and launch for QLess (Virtual Queing System), onboarding and support for Runtriz (mobile ordering), and advanced analytics and reporting for all mobile and digital platforms. 

Paul Ford, Group Product Manager, Overstock

Paul Ford is the Group Product Manager for Overstock.com’s Customer Organization where he manages the strategy and implementation for the company’s customer-centric product vision. In this role, Ford directly manages a world-class product team. Additionally, he oversees development for customer care, customer experience, user-generated content, customer loyalty, self-service experience, my account, payments, financing options, gift cards, as well as Overstock’s cutting edge CRM and customer identity systems.

Ford joined Overstock’s team two years ago as a product manager in marketing, where he developed technological solutions for push, email, customer identity, and marketing tag management. His 18 years of experience as a business and technology leader resulted in Overstock winning the Braze Customer of the Year award in 2019 as the company reached new heights in marketing tech and customer experience.

As Overstock continues its 21-year success as a tech-focused ecommerce company Ford and his teams will continue to develop and utilize new features, new products, and new customer experiences.
